My guess is that you haven't installed becomeroot; and if you can't install
anything
, then you can't install becomeroot now; and if you can't install becomeroot, I don't see how you can be in root in Xterm.
If you have becomeroot installed, you just open Xterm -- look around your list of applications and you'll find it -- and type
sudo gainroot
and then click enter. Your prompt will change from $ to #. Then type what I have in Post #7 and click enter.
But if you enter "sudo gainroot" and that doesn't get you to the # prompt, then I don't know what you can do other than flash the device and start over. (Before flashing, first do a backup.)
